90-794 USAF 164 AS 90-1794 "City of Crestline" May 2008 Details
USAF C-130H #90-1794 from 164 AS is seen doing a flypast with special 60th Anniversary markings at the Cleveland Air Show on August 30, 2008. [Photo by Jason Grant]
Wore special markings for the squadrons 60th Anniversary, 1948 to 2008. Markings are from a P-51D with checkered cowlings and D-day stripes as the unit is a descendant of the 363rd FS.
91-238 USAF 165 AS 91-1238 "Foolish Pleasure" 15 May 2019 Details
USAF C-130J #07-46312 from the 165 AS takes off from the Kentucky ANGB in Louisville on June 1, 2019, en route to France, where it will participate in the 75th-anniversary reenactment of D-Day. The aircraft, which has been striped with historically accurate Allied Forces livery, will airdrop U.S. Army paratroopers over Normandy on June 9 as part of the commemoration. [ANG photo by Dale Greer]
Invasion stripes applied for 75th Anniversary of D-Day
